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Прочее";
Текущий архив: 2013.09.08;
Скачать: [xml.tar.bz2];

Вниз

Windows 7 и файл подкачки   Найти похожие ветки 

 
Optimaiser   (2013-03-30 02:38) [0]

Всем привет! Поставил себе Виндовс 7 ultimate 64бит, оперативы 8гб(ddr3). Полет нормальный :-)Можно ли отключить файл подкачки и как это отобразится на производительности? Погуглив, внятного ответа не нашел :-(


 
Германн ©   (2013-03-30 02:56) [1]


> Погуглив, внятного ответа не нашел

И тут не найдёшь. :)


 
Германн ©   (2013-03-30 03:05) [2]

Зачем понадобилось отключать файл подкачки?


 
Киноман   (2013-03-30 04:45) [3]

По легендам винт тормознутее оперативы :-)


 
Eraser ©   (2013-03-30 05:35) [4]

ничего не нужно отключать.


 
Inovet ©   (2013-03-30 06:53) [5]

> [2] Германн ©   (30.03.13 03:05)
> Зачем понадобилось отключать файл подкачки?

Есть поверье - файл подкачки жутко тормозит, заговор Билла Гейтса и прочих масонов.


 
brother ©   (2013-03-30 08:54) [6]

отключи и посмотри, будет ли хватать для работы...


 
TUser ©   (2013-03-30 09:01) [7]

Практика - критерий истины. Сам попробуй, имхо.


 
brother ©   (2013-03-30 09:03) [8]

это мне ответ?


 
antonn ©   (2013-03-30 12:20) [9]


> Всем привет! Поставил себе Виндовс 7 ultimate 64бит, оперативы
> 8гб(ddr3). Полет нормальный :-)Можно ли отключить файл подкачки
> и как это отобразится на производительности? Погуглив, внятного
> ответа не нашел :-(

имел 12Гб оперативки и 12Гб подкачки. Поставил 32Гб оперативки и 500Мб подкачки, разницы не увидел. Поставил 500Мб при 4Гб оперативки и на следующий день не увидел машину в сети, т.к. там приключилась ошибка в каком-то "винлогоне" и сеть вырубилась :) Т.ч. сам прикидывай будет ли у тебя всегда свободная оперативка и готов ли ты рискнуть


 
Optimaiser   (2013-03-30 13:21) [10]

Наверно 2гб на своп хватит думаю :-)


 
Дмитрий С ©   (2013-03-30 13:46) [11]

У меня 7x64 и 8 GB озу (больше не втыкается). Файл подкачки отключил, ни разу еще не получил сообщение о том что памяти мало осталось, хотя вечно сто тыщ окон открыто.


 
Optimaiser   (2013-03-30 14:18) [12]

>Дмитрий У меня та же винда и рама, тоже надеюсь шо должно хватить 8гиг :-) Проблем с софтом для 64бит нет? Дельфи нормально пашет? Какая версия?


 
robt   (2013-03-30 14:40) [13]

сидел на 8г 3 года без подкачки, но проблем


 
robt   (2013-03-30 14:41) [14]

при необходимости всплывет облачко с предложением закрыть самые жадные проги


 
Игорь Шевченко ©   (2013-03-30 14:48) [15]

Мешает он вам, файл подкачки ? или вы считаете, что если он есть, то сразу начинает активно использоваться ?

Performance counters - rulezz fareva


 
брат Птибурдукова   (2013-03-30 15:39) [16]


> при необходимости всплывет облачко с предложением закрыть
> самые жадные проги
Да по идее ситуация прямо противоположная: с подкачкой будет ругаться, что "виртуальная память кончается, позакрывайте ненужную GUIту", а без подкачки тупо начнут вылетать случайные проги по out of memory.


 
111   (2013-03-30 16:35) [17]

win7 x64 4 гига оперативки, файл подкачки 4 гига, выставлен по умолчанию при инсталле (я сейчас даже с трудом нашел, где его смотреть то)
никакого дискомфорта не ощущаю, менять смысла не вижу
запущено постоянно много чего


 
Inovet ©   (2013-03-30 17:46) [18]

> [15] Игорь Шевченко ©   (30.03.13 14:48)
> Мешает он вам, файл подкачки ?

Оптимизаторы, такие оптимизаторы...


 
Дмитрий С ©   (2013-03-30 19:30) [19]

Я отключил файл подкачки с одной лишь целью - чтобы бы долгосвернутые программы быстро разворачивались - это все.


 
Игорь Шевченко ©   (2013-03-30 19:37) [20]

Дмитрий С ©   (30.03.13 19:30) [19]

А какая связь ?


 
Optimaiser   (2013-03-30 22:43) [21]

Похоже при 8гб и больше рам своп не нужен и лишь тормозит ось:-)


 
Дмитрий С ©   (2013-03-31 01:24) [22]


> Дмитрий С ©   (30.03.13 19:30) [19]
>
> А какая связь ?

Файл подкачки включен - долгосвернутые приложение долго разворачиваются (лампочка обращения к жесткому диску при этом светится почти непрерываясь)

Файл подкачки выключен - долгосвернутое приложение разворачивается быстро, жесткий диск при этом не страдает.

При это не имеет значения сколько оперативы вставлено - наша любимая ОС все же не брезгует скинуть часть и без того свободной памяти на диск.


 
Германн ©   (2013-03-31 01:38) [23]


> Дмитрий С ©   (31.03.13 01:24) [22]
>
>
> > Дмитрий С ©   (30.03.13 19:30) [19]
> >
> > А какая связь ?
>
> Файл подкачки включен - долгосвернутые приложение долго
> разворачиваются

А что за зверь долгосвернутое приложение?
Почему у меня все свёрнутые приложения разворачиваются мгновенно?


 
antonn ©   (2013-03-31 02:18) [24]


> Почему у меня все свёрнутые приложения разворачиваются мгновенно?

superfetch


 
Германн ©   (2013-03-31 02:33) [25]


> antonn ©   (31.03.13 02:18) [24]
>
>
> > Почему у меня все свёрнутые приложения разворачиваются
> мгновенно?
>
> superfetch
>

Но я не покупал никакой superfetch.
:)
Все настойки по умолчанию. Что в ХР, что в семёрке. Да и ОЗУ у меня всего 2 ГБ. :)


 
antonn ©   (2013-03-31 02:37) [26]

значит у тебя такие приложения


 
Германн ©   (2013-03-31 02:55) [27]


> antonn ©   (31.03.13 02:37) [26]
>
> значит у тебя такие приложения
>  

Вот я и спрашивал о том, что это  за "долгосвернутое приложение". Может объяснишь?


 
robt   (2013-03-31 11:00) [28]


> брат Птибурдукова   (30.03.13 15:39) [16]

дело не в идее и теории, а в практике, если ты невнимательно читал [13]


 
antonn ©   (2013-03-31 12:10) [29]


> Вот я и спрашивал о том, что это  за "долгосвернутое приложение".
>  Может объяснишь?

это то, к чему применили SetProcessWorkingSetSize и страницы ушли в своп


 
Inovet ©   (2013-03-31 12:13) [30]

А я вот что думаю: если приложение долго свётнуто, следовательно часто не разворчивается, а, значит, пофиг 1 секунду или 10.


 
Игорь Шевченко ©   (2013-03-31 12:48) [31]

"У вас может сложиться впечатление, что отсутствие файла подкачки может благотворно сказаться на производительности, однако в общем случае то, что у Windows в распоряжении будет файл подкачки, означает, что ОС сможет размещать некоторые записи (которые используются нечасто и не сохранены на диск) в файл подкачки, освобождая тем самым память для более полезных задач (процессы и кэши файлов). Так что даже если в некоторых случаях отсутствие файла подкачки может увеличить производительность, в общем случае его наличие означает, что в распоряжении системы будет больше доступной памяти (Windows в случае сбоя не сможет сделать дамп памяти, занятой под процессы ядра, если в ее распоряжении не будет достаточно большого файла подкачки). "

http://blogs.technet.com/b/mark_russinovich/archive/2008/11/17/3182311.aspx


 
wl ©   (2013-03-31 14:32) [32]

где-то когда-то читал что отсутсвие файла подкачки приводит к нестабильности работы некоторых программ, типа фотошопа, не помню точно.
одним словом, от отключения файла подкачки одни проблемы, теб более с таким мизерным количеством физической оперативки (8гб)


 
Игорь Шевченко ©   (2013-03-31 15:12) [33]


> это то, к чему применили SetProcessWorkingSetSize и страницы
> ушли в своп


Мифы древней Греции. Страницы не обязательно ушли в своп, страницы кода, например, в своп не уходят.


 
antonn ©   (2013-03-31 15:18) [34]


> Страницы не обязательно ушли в своп

конечно не обязательно, но так понятней куда я клоню


 
Inovet ©   (2013-03-31 15:26) [35]

> [33] Игорь Шевченко ©   (31.03.13 15:12)
> страницы кода, например, в своп не уходят.

Потому что и так код на память отображён из исполняемого файла?


 
Игорь Шевченко ©   (2013-03-31 15:35) [36]

Inovet ©   (31.03.13 15:26) [35]

Да, для страниц кода "свопом" служит сам исполняемый файл. И если после активизации "долгосвернутого" приложения наблюдается активность жесткого диска, то это может быть повторное чтение нужных частей исполняемого файла.


 
Inovet ©   (2013-03-31 16:32) [37]

> [36] Игорь Шевченко ©   (31.03.13 15:35)

Отимизаторам. Срочно отключить отображение файлов, как злые происки масонов.


 
брат Птибурдукова   (2013-03-31 16:51) [38]

Ну дык… Однажды тут одна известная на форуме личность наличие у винчестеров буфера приписала не менее как заговору производителей.


 
Дмитрий С ©   (2013-03-31 16:58) [39]


> Да, для страниц кода "свопом" служит сам исполняемый файл.

И настройки файла подкачки на это никак не влияют, правильно?


 
Inovet ©   (2013-03-31 17:27) [40]

> [38] брат Птибурдукова   (31.03.13 16:51)

Очень интересно. В чём суть заговора?


 
брат Птибурдукова   (2013-03-31 17:38) [41]


> В чём суть заговора?
буфер не нуж0н (потому что ему непонятно, зачем он), поэтому буферизацию винчестера и двухъядерные процессоры ему навязывают недобросовестные производители :-((((((


 
Игорь Шевченко ©   (2013-03-31 17:47) [42]

Дмитрий С ©   (31.03.13 16:58) [39]


> И настройки файла подкачки на это никак не влияют, правильно?


Для незапакованных незашифрованных приложений - не влияют


 
Inovet ©   (2013-03-31 18:04) [43]

> [41] брат Птибурдукова   (31.03.13 17:38)

Ужас какой. Как же жить теперь.


 
Sapersky   (2013-03-31 18:50) [44]


> Игорь Шевченко ©   (31.03.13 12:48) [31]
"ОС сможет размещать некоторые записи (которые используются нечасто и не сохранены на диск) в файл подкачки, освобождая тем самым память для более полезных задач (процессы и кэши файлов)"

Вот только критерии "полезности" странные - файловый кэш считается важнее фонового приложения.
Если бы можно было это настраивать, то я бы предпочёл менее агрессивное кэширование. Пусть файлы копируются медленнее (не так часто нужно много копировать), но переключение приложений будет быстрее. Так было в "тёплой ламповой" Win98, кстати.
Пытался гуглить по поводу такой настройки - не нашёл.

> Да, для страниц кода "свопом" служит сам исполняемый файл.
И настройки файла подкачки на это никак не влияют, правильно?


Хоть бы и не влияли.
Вот сейчас опера у меня занимает 700 мб, это всё код, что ли? Наверное, всё-таки данные...


 
robt   (2013-03-31 19:58) [45]


> некоторых программ, типа фотошопа

сказка, у фотошопа свои файлы "подкачки", а зависнуть с месагой "нехватает памяти" он может на любой системе
также помним что большинство используемых прог х32 и больше 2г памяти несхавают, хоть с подкачкой, хоть с водокачкой


 
Игорь Шевченко ©   (2013-03-31 20:10) [46]

Sapersky   (31.03.13 18:50) [44]


> Пытался гуглить по поводу такой настройки - не нашёл.


Руссинович с Соломоном довольно подробно объясняют, где, как и какие гайки крутить для настройки поведения диспетчера виртуальной памяти.
Конкретно эта гайка, если мне не изменяет память, называется LargeSystemCache.

Ну и
http://msdn.microsoft.com/ru-RU/library/windows/desktop/bb870880(v=vs.85).aspx


 
Игорь Шевченко ©   (2013-03-31 20:13) [47]

до кучи
http://technet.microsoft.com/en-us/library/cc938581.aspx


 
Sapersky   (2013-03-31 23:20) [48]

Ну кое-что я находил, и в частности LargeSystemCache. По умолчанию эта опция обычно выключена, а включать мне не надо, т.к. цель уменьшить кэш.
Первая ссылка пока не подходит, под рукой нет 32-битной системы, потом попробую.
По второй вроде бы подходит SystemPages: "this change prevents expanding the system cache by 464 MB (limiting it to 512 MB)" - но не работает, во всяком случае, в диспетчере задач под кэш выделено больше 512 мб. Возможно, это тоже только для 32-битных. Да и хотелось бы более гибкой настройки, а не "512 мб/дофига".

В целом по итогам гуглопоисков сложилось впечатление, что однозначного решения нет, есть какие-то костыли вроде отдельных настроек для каждого приложения (понижение приоритета ввода-вывода), и то не всегда работающие.

Руссиновича и Соломона попробую почитать, если не будет слишком лень :)


 
NailMan ©   (2013-04-02 17:02) [49]

Вчера сменив платформу и поставив на нее 32гиг оперативы выключать подкачку не собираюсь и никому не советую. Вся оператива выедается при прокачке через сеть киношек. Хавает под кэш как хлеб


 
antonn ©   (2013-04-02 18:39) [50]


> NailMan ©   (02.04.13 17:02) [49]

на какой ОС? на сервере 2008r2 под сервером терминалов (1-2 юзера онлайн), на hiper-v постоянно работают 4 машины (3 ХР и 2008), без стеснения запускаются по пять копий браузеров с кучей вкладок, и все это с аптаймом месяц - занято постоянно 10Гб из 32-х и почти не отклоняется. При этом система работает как NAS для остальных (т.е. и на нее и с нее много качается и смотрится), в ней же торренты качаются.


 
NoUser   (2013-04-02 20:34) [51]

> т.к. цель уменьшить кэш. ??
> Хавает под кэш как хлеб
Ну и что, попросите (GetMem) у системы большой кусок этого хлеба - и получите. Смотрите не на слово "Кэшировано", а на "Доступно".

> выключать подкачку не собираюсь и никому не советую
Поддерживаю, но для получения новых знаний (когда RАМы >4GB) рекомендую задать Min(32MB) -Max(RAMSIZE) и посматривать на размер pagefile.sys



Страницы: 1 2 вся ветка

Форум: "Прочее";
Текущий архив: 2013.09.08;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.58 MB
Время: 0.003 c
10-1185282081
niko_
2007-07-24 17:01
2013.09.08
Получение свойств COM-объектов расположенных на форме


2-1356284195
Pcrepair
2012-12-23 21:36
2013.09.08
использование TStringList в доп. модуле


2-1356226571
Den
2012-12-23 05:36
2013.09.08
TEMPLATE. Как при создании события в редакторе кода сделать...


1-1312895488
DrDobro
2011-08-09 17:11
2013.09.08
chm файл


15-1364802724
O'ShinW
2013-04-01 11:52
2013.09.08
Задачка. Бесконечная шоколадка :)





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ский